Betamethasone and Triamcinolone produced by NECC are contaminated


It is widely reported about the meningitis outbreak which has occurred in certain states of America. Contaminated Methylprednisolone Acetate injections resulted in fungal meningitis in more than 500 patients. The contamination turned out to be tragic for 39 patients: they died. The majority of deaths took place in Tennessee.
It was defined that contaminated steroid injections had been manufactured by the New England Compounding Center (NECC) that is located in Massachusetts. The FDA tested the company in order to define what resulted in contamination and see the situation at the NECC. It was affirmed by the FDA that the contaminated steroid injections were indeed produced by this compounding pharmacy.
According to the Associated Press, the FDA claimed that it was obvious that manufacture of medications was unsterile at the NECC. The FDA noticed that leaking water and uncontrolled temperature were just some problems at the company. The equipment used for preparing of solution for injections was unsterile.
Furthermore, the FDA stated that there were several other contaminants. Several bacterial contaminants were found at the NECC. Although these contaminants were not real pathogens, they could result in infection too. These bacterial contaminants were found in such preparations, as Betamethasone and Triamcinolone. There were not any situations reported about contamination caused by usage of these medications. But it was claimed that these medicines were also capable to cause contamination. However the bacterial contaminants were anywhere in the environment, they had not to be in drugs. This fact pointed at unsterile conditions at the compounding center and affirmed that the Methylprednisolone Acetate injections turned out to be contaminated with fungal meningitis because they were manufactured in improper conditions.
The situation made it clear that new rules on pharmacies should be implemented. Contamination should be prevented. Otherwise, public health is in danger in the USA.
